ABSTRACT
The
nosocomial pulmonary infection is one of the most common complications of Coal
Workers Pneumoconiosis(C.W.P.). It is also one of the main precipitating
factors of respiratory failure, pulmonary encephalopuncture, severe acute cor
pulmonale and one of the main death cause of
C.W.P. The article is concerned with
retrospective investigation on 66 cases of C.W.P’s patients during period of
the hospital, complicated with the pulmonary infections in clinical
manifestation and with the positive result of sputum bacteria culture for 119
specimens. It is indicated to the
C.W.P’s patients in the nosocomial pulmonary infections associated with severe
dispnia that the prodution of large amount of sputum and characteristic change of
sputum, appearing moist rales in lungs were commonly observed in the main
symptoms and signs. It’s mainly on
Gram-negative bacillus of sputum bacteria culture.(78.99%). The mortality rate is 23%. Therefore, it is clinical significance of
paying attention to the early diagnosis of C.W.P. complicated with nosocomial
pulmonary infections and using reasonably antibiotic according to bacteria
culture and drug sensitive test.
